Ten Explosion-proof Measures for Dangerous Chemicals
Release time:
2019-09-06 14:51
Hazardous chemicals are dangerous and explosive, and there are huge potential safety hazards in daily safety production. In order to prevent hazardous chemicals from exploding and other hazards, you should do the following ten points.
1 Basic measures
(1) Control of combustibles:
Stores with inflammable and explosive hazardous substances shall be constructed with fire-resistant buildings to prevent the spread of flame;
Reduce the concentration of combustible gas, steam and dust in the reservoir area so that it does not exceed the maximum allowable concentration;
All items that can interact with each other by nature shall be stored separately.
(2) Isolation of air:
Isolated air storage of some chemical flammable items, such as sodium stored in kerosene, phosphorus stored in dry water, carbon disulfide water closed storage.
(3) Remove ignition source:
Remove the ignition source, isolate the fire source, control the temperature, ground, protect the lightning, install the explosion-proof lamp, block the sunlight, etc., to prevent the combustible materials from catching fire due to open flame or temperature increase.
2 Fire control
Control the ignition source on the maintenance or construction site, including open flame, impact friction, natural heating, electric spark, electrostatic spark, etc;
It is forbidden to use open flame in the reservoir area with fire and explosion danger;
Hot work permit shall be obtained for open fire operation such as electric and gas welding due to special circumstances;
Clear flammable and combustible materials in the hot work area; configure fire fighting equipment. Hot work construction personnel must be certified.
3 Friction and impact control
Maintain good lubrication during the operation of auxiliary facilities and pumps, and remove the attached combustible dirt in time;
When handling metal containers containing combustible gas and flammable liquid, avoid mutual collision and throw them, so as to avoid fire and explosion accidents caused by spark or container burst. Personnel entering and leaving the container shall not wear shoes with nails.
When loading, unloading, handling, light unloading, anti-vibration, impact friction, heavy pressure and dumping.
4 Natural heat control
Oil rags, oil cotton yarn, etc. are likely to cause fire, so they should be put into metal containers, placed in safe areas and cleaned up in time.
5 Electric spark control
The main low-voltage electrical equipment used in the reservoir area will often produce short-term arc discharge and weak sparks on the contacts, which will pose a danger to combustible gas, flammable liquid vapor and explosive dust with low ignition energy. Therefore, explosion-proof type should be selected for electrical equipment and wiring.
6 electrostatic spark control
Some friends may think that static electricity is a small matter and do not take it to heart. That would be a big mistake!
The most serious static electricity can lead to combustible combustion and explosion, especially for combustible gas or steam with small ignition energy. In places with gasoline, benzene, hydrogen and other places, special attention should be paid to static hazards. Personnel entering and leaving the country should wear anti-static work clothes. The flow rate should be controlled during pipeline transportation. The bulk chemical tank truck should have reliable static grounding parts and detect and alarm the static grounding resistance, the entire system should suppress static electricity generation or quickly export static electricity.
7 Other fire source control
Avoid direct sunlight and configure corresponding cooling measures;
Indoor warehouse to avoid long-term baking of high-power lighting, the use of cold light source;
Fireworks are strictly prohibited in the reservoir area;
Prohibit the use of handling tools that may produce sparks;
It is strictly prohibited to use non-explosion-proof mobile phones.
8 to prevent the spread of flame and blast wave
The function of the fire retardant device is to prevent the flame from entering the equipment, containers and pipelines, or to prevent the flame from expanding in the equipment and pipelines. Common fire retardant equipment has safety water seal, flame arrester and one-way valve.
Transportation vehicles entering the flammable and explosive reservoir area shall be inspected with "three certificates" and equipped with fireproof cover and small fireproof equipment.
For storage facilities with pressure, the pressure relief device is an important safety device for fire and explosion prevention, including safety valve, rupture disc and vent pipe.
9 Other considerations
When storing unstable olefins and diolefins, measures should be taken to prevent self-polymerization, because the self-polymerization process will release heat and increase the risk of fire and explosion.
Indicating devices, such as pressure gauges (liquefied gas storage, etc.), thermometers, level gauges and high-level alarms (flammable liquid storage tanks), can be used for regular inspection or calibration and verification. In addition, the tank area should also be set up lightning protection, anti-static device, once a year to detect.
10 Emergency Equipment
In the key parts prone to fire and explosion, the automatic monitoring system of combustible gas, fire alarm device and fire extinguishing sprinkler device are installed (because liquid chemicals are mostly lighter than water, fire extinguishing with water will lead to the expansion of fire range), regular maintenance or testing, calibration, equipped with rescue equipment should have explosion-proof function.
According to different storage materials and storage conditions, the emergency plan is formulated.
